      <description>APNA holds two national conferences each year, the CPI Conference in June and the Annual Conference in October. The association also tries to make available as many continuing education opportunities to its members as possible. This area of the site organizes these offerings into one place.</description>

	The Clinical Psychopharmacology Institute focuses on complex clinical issues addressing the most current practices and insights on clinical psychopharmacology. CPI is&amp;nbsp;appropriate for&amp;nbsp;generalist and advanced practice&amp;nbsp;psychiatric nurses - especially those who administer and/or prescribe medications.</description>
